## Deploying Schema Migrations (Zero Downtime)

Welcome aboard! At Quillforge we never take the database down for a migration. The trick: every change ships in two phases — expand first (add columns, backfill), contract later (drop old stuff) only after all app nodes are on the new code. The migrator runs as a sidecar on the Larkspur cluster and acquires an advisory lock so only one instance applies changes. Before your first deploy, double-check the migrator's settings, which are reproduced here for reference.

config for kagup-hahig:
druwyn:
  pin: 2801
  metrics_host: metrics.druwyn.zemvarlabs.internal
  tenant: sorius
  seal: seal_798a43d7

Subject: Tarnwell Group term sheet

Tarnwell has delivered a revised term sheet covering co-distribution of the Ashgrove line across the eastern territories. Key terms: three-year exclusivity, shared marketing fund, volume-based rebates. Legal flags the termination clause; Finance flags the rebate cap. Department heads must submit impact assessments by Friday. No external discussion until the steering group signs off. Full commercial implications are captured in the confidential note appended below.

internal memo for kawip-hadug: Headcount on the Wenwyn team goes from 7 to 140 by the end of January. Gross margin on Wenwyn came in at 20 percent against a plan of 15 percent.

CI note — Scholaris timetable solver. If the nightly job fails at the constraint-propagation stage, it is usually the fixture generator producing an infeasible room set, not your change. Re-run with the seeded fixtures first; only escalate if both seeded runs fail. Logs live under the solver-nightly artifact bundle. When filing an escalation, quote the failing pipeline's build token shown below.

session token of tajef-bageg = htk21_5d90d574934f3ccae6437

## Limits and quotas: Stagelight seat-map renderer

Plugin authors extending the Stagelight renderer for the Verranto Playhouse should respect the platform's hard limits on seat count per canvas, zoom levels, and concurrent overlay layers. Exceeding them causes the renderer to degrade to static mode rather than fail, but your plugin will be throttled. Plan your layouts around the quota constants given here.

tuning table, yajog-yahof:
BUDGETS = {
    "lamvan": 303,
    "wenox": 460,
    "fenvan": 525,
}